3. Cookies and Other Tracking Technologies

Cookies are small text files stored by your web browser when you use websites. You can control or delete cookies through your browser settings. Note that if you disable cookies entirely, our Services may not function properly.

We currently use only cookies that are essential for the core functionality of our Services. We do not currently use cookies for advertising or analytics purposes. If we introduce such cookies in the future, we will update this Policy and, where required by applicable laws, obtain your consent before doing so.

3.1. Types of Cookies

We may use both session cookies and persistent cookies. A session cookie disappears after you close your browser. A persistent cookie remains after you close your browser and may be used by your browser on subsequent visits to our Services. We or our third-party partners may place cookies under one of the following purposes:

  • Function cookies: these cookies are essential for the core functionality of the site and related services. Without them, the site cannot function properly, so they cannot be disabled.
  • Marketing cookies: these cookies allow us and our partners to deliver ads that are more relevant to your interests for marketing purposes. Without them, you will still see ads, but they may not be as tailored to your preferences.
  • Measurement cookies:these cookies are used to analyze site usage, helping us measure and improve site performance. Without these cookies, we wouldn't be able to understand which content is most valued or track how often unique visitors return, making it difficult to enhance the information we provide to you.

At present, we only use function cookies. We do not currently use marketing cookies or measurement cookies.

5.2. How do we retain your personal data

We adhere to retention policies for the personal data we collect to ensure that it is not retained longer than necessary for the intended purpose.

Specifically, when you delete your account or request the deletion of your personal data, we will delete or anonymize your personal data without undue delay and in any event within 7 days, except in the following cases:

  • Compliance with legal requirements regarding data retention according to the applicable laws. For example, transaction and billing records are retained for the period required by applicable tax and accounting laws.
  • Extension of the period for financial, audit, dispute resolution, or other legitimate purposes.

Residual copies of your personal data may remain in our backup systems for a limited period. Such copies are isolated from active use, are not processed for any other purpose, and are purged within 30 days in accordance with our backup rotation cycle.

In addition, our access and system logs, which are used for security, troubleshooting, and service stability purposes, are retained for 90 days and are then deleted or anonymized.

When assessing how long your personal data is retained, we consider criteria such as: (i) the nature of the personal data and the activities involved; (ii) when and for how long you use the Services; and (iii) our legitimate interests and our legal obligations.
